> Here is the info from Dylan McCall :
> >
> > (Unfortunately), this is intentional. Mozilla's trademark
> policy
> > blocks
> > us from distributing the real icon with the package, and
> pointing to
> > the
> > icon installed to the system means we get either the branded
> or
> > unbranded icon based on what system the slideshow is running
> on. It
> > won't load that icon when running from the web, because a
> web site can
> > only use local resources if it is itself stored locally.
>
> Just to have an icon, i have modified the slide to display a
> generic web
> png... but on an Ubuntu system it will show and Firefox icon.
